Slowcooker Monterey Chicken

Ingredients:
*3-4 chicken breasts
*1 clove garlic, minced
*2 tsp. chili powder
*1 tsp. oregano
*1 tsp. cumin
*1 tsp. salt
*1 14 oz. can diced tomatoes, including juices
*juice from one lime
*1 Tbsp. flour
*1/2 c. chicken broth
*2 c. shredded Monterey Jack cheese

Directions:
1.) Mix chicken broth and flour in a small bowl to make a thickener. Set aside.
2.) Add to the crock pot the rest of the ingredients except the chicken and cheese.
3.) Pour the chicken broth mixture in, and then add the chicken on top.
4.) Cook on low 7-8 hours.
5.) Take chicken out and shred it.
6.) Put it back in the crock pot, along with the cheese.
7.) Let it cook for another 10-20 minutes on high, or until cheese is melted.
8.) Serve over rice or in a tortilla.

slow cooker lasagna

Ingredients:
*1 lb.ground beef
*1 jar (26 oz) spaghetti sauce
*1 cup water
*1 15oz container ricotta cheese
*2 cups mozzarella cheese, divided
*1/4 cup grated parmesan, divided
*1 egg
*1 onion, chopped
*2 tbsp italian seasoning or oregano
*6 lasagna noodles uncooked

Directions:
1.) Brown meat and onion in skillet, drain.
2.) Stir in spaghetti sauce and water.
3.) Mix ricotta, 1 1/2 cups mozzarella, 2 tbsp spices, 1/4 cup parm, egg and spice in seperate bowl
4.) Spoon 1 cup meat sauce into slow cooker, top with 3 noodles broken to fit, followed by 1/2 cheese mixture
5.) Cover with 2 cups of remaining sauce.
6.) Top with remaining noodles broken to fit, cheese mixture and meat sauce, cover with lid
7.) Cook on low 4-6 hours or until liquid is absorbed.
8.) Sprinkle with remaining cheese, let stand, covered 10 min or until cheese is melted.

Why Didn't I Think of That--Chicken

I was recently talking with a friend of mine about what we were making for dinner that night. I told her I had a bottle of BBQ sauce and some chicken breasts in the slow cooker. She was shocked and amazed that she didn't think of that herself. Being inspired by that phone conversation--here are some things that I have done in my slow cooker with a few chicken breasts and 1-2 ingredients:

*3-4 Chicken breasts; bottle of BBQ sauce--cook on low 5-6 hours
*3-4 Chicken breasts; bottle of Italian salad dressing--cook on low 5-6 hours
*3-4 Chicken breasts; jar of salsa--cook on low 5-6 hours
